Editing or deleting the last contour element
Editing the last contour element
: When the
Change last
soft key
is pressed, the data of the
last
contour element are presented for
editing.
Depending on the adjoining contour elements, corrections of linear
or circular elements are either transferred immediately or the
corrected contour is displayed for inspection.
ICP
highlights the
affected contour elements in color. If there are several possible
solutions, you can check all mathematically possible solutions with
the
next solution
and
previous solution
soft keys.
The change will not become effective until you confirm by soft key.
If you discard the change, the
old
description becomes effective
again.
The type of contour element (linear or circular element), the
direction of a linear element, or the direction of rotation of a circular
element cannot be changed. Should this be necessary, you must
delete the element and add a new contour element.
Deleting the last contour element
: When the
Delete last
soft
key is pressed, the data of the
last
contour element are discarded.
You can use this function repeatedly to delete several successive
contour elements.
Deleting contour elements
Deleting a contour element:
Select the
Manipulate
menu item
The menu displays functions for trimming,
editing and deleting contours
Select the
Delete
menu item
Select the
Element/range
menu item
Select the contour element to be deleted
Delete the contour element
You can delete several successive contour elements.
